RBC Capital Markets deploys Aiden deep reinforcement learning platform to minimize VWAP slippage in European markets

The Challenge

Traditional pre-set algorithmic trading strategies struggled with slippage and alpha erosion during periods of volatility. Historical models could be upended by shifting market conditions, requiring frequent manual re-coding to maintain effectiveness. Traders needed a solution that could adapt in real-time to dynamic liquidity patterns and market microstructure changes.

The Solution

RBC and its Borealis AI research institute developed Aiden, an electronic trading platform using deep reinforcement learning to adjust to market conditions in real-time. The Aiden VWAP algorithm processes more than 200 market data inputs through a deep neural network, learning autonomously from performance both during and after each trade. A companion Aiden Insights explanation system provides clients real-time visibility into how the algorithm is adapting its execution decisions.

Results

After debuting in North America in 2020, Aiden demonstrated the ability to swiftly adapt to volatile market changes while preserving performance without frequent manual re-coding. The platform was subsequently launched in UK and European markets in 2024, extending its adaptive execution capabilities to those regions. A second algorithm, Aiden Arrival Price (launched in North America in 2022), expanded the platform's capabilities with over 300 data inputs and a more flexible execution trajectory.

Key Takeaways

  • Deep reinforcement learning enables trading algorithms to self-optimize continuously, removing the need for manual recoding during volatile periods.
  • Explainability tools (Aiden Insights) are critical for client adoption of black-box AI trading systems, giving coverage teams a way to communicate real-time decisions.
  • Expanding from 200 to 300+ inputs across algorithm generations reflects a deliberate evolutionary roadmap, not a single deployment.
